My Buying Guides on Queen Low Loft Bed
Why I Considered a Queen Low Loft Bed
When I started looking for a bed that could save space without feeling too cramped, a queen low loft bed immediately stood out to me. I liked the idea of having a raised sleeping area while still keeping the height low enough to feel safer and more practical for everyday use. For me, it was a smart middle ground between a standard bed and a full loft setup.
What I Looked for First
My first priority was stability. Since a queen bed is already larger and heavier than smaller sizes, I wanted a frame that felt sturdy and well-built. I also paid close attention to the height of the loft. I didn’t want something so high that it felt difficult to climb into, but I still wanted enough clearance underneath for storage or a small workspace.
Material and Build Quality
I found that the material made a big difference in how confident I felt about the bed. Metal frames usually seemed more modern and durable to me, while wood frames gave a warmer and more traditional look. I personally focused on thick support legs, reinforced joints, and a strong slat system because those details made me feel the bed would last longer and support weight better.
Safety Features I Paid Attention To
Safety was one of my biggest concerns. I looked for guardrails that were high enough to keep me secure while sleeping, especially since the bed is elevated. I also made sure the ladder felt easy to climb and had a design that wouldn’t slip or wobble. For me, rounded edges and a solid frame were also important because they made the bed feel more user-friendly.
Space Under the Bed
One of the main reasons I liked a low loft design was the extra space underneath. I considered whether I wanted to use that area for storage bins, a desk, or just open floor space. Before buying, I measured my room carefully so I could be sure the under-bed clearance would actually be useful in my setup.
Comfort and Mattress Compatibility
I learned quickly that not every mattress works well with a loft bed frame. I checked the recommended mattress thickness so the mattress wouldn’t sit too high and reduce the guardrail safety. I also made sure the mattress would fit the frame properly without sliding around. Comfort mattered to me, but I didn’t want to sacrifice safety for a thicker mattress.
Assembly and Maintenance
I preferred a bed that looked manageable to assemble, especially if I was doing it myself or with limited help. Clear instructions, labeled parts, and simple hardware made a big difference in my experience. I also thought about maintenance. A frame that was easy to tighten, clean, and inspect seemed much more practical in the long run.
